The site, like the store has a selection of better goods by known
labels and designers. House wares, men’s and women’s
apparel, gifts, accessories, kids stuff and jewelry all at their
bargain pricing of 20%-60% off.
Since The TJX Group owns Marshall’s, TJ Maxx and Homegood’s
you can expect a good selection in every category. I found kids
apparel and swimwear with an exceptional buy in a boys Claiborne
3-piece suit for $49.99 instead of $100 and an Oshkosh girls denim
jumper for $9.99 instead of $20. A nice cream colored queen sized
quilt was sold out in the store closet to me last week. But it was
online at the same low price of $39.99. Some large colorful beach
towels were $12.99 instead of $17.They even had those cool home
accents from plant stands ($14-$19) to a small storage ottoman ($24).
There are shoes here but in very limited sizing. The apparel had
a reasonable selection of sizes from petites to plus and you’ll
find the same well know designers on line at the same good prices
you do in their stores.
Shipping charges run anywhere from $3.95 to $24.95. Shipping charges
are not refundable but you can return online purchases (new w/tags
and a receipt) to their stores for credit…. An added plus.
